What Is the UAE Golden Visa?

The Golden Visa is a long-term residency permit introduced by the UAE government to attract global talent, investors, and innovators. Unlike regular residency permits, it allows foreign nationals to live, work, and study in the UAE without needing a local sponsor. Depending on eligibility, the visa is granted for 5 or 10 years and is renewable.

Family Sponsorship for Pakistani Citizens

A major advantage of the UAE Golden Visa is family sponsorship. Pakistani applicants can sponsor their spouse, children of any age, and in some cases parents. This ensures the whole family enjoys stability, education opportunities, and healthcare access. Spouses can work or manage businesses, while children gain access to leading schools and universities in the UAE.
